With the ever-increasing dominance of capitalist logic over the late and contemporary era, accompanied by the expansion of ideologies aligned with this condition, all social and cultural spheres inevitably undergo fundamental changes. As these spheres become more abstractly dependent on the social system’s overall structure, the remaining reality of them turns into meaningless and sometimes worn-out heaps, which seem to have originally held self-contained meanings aligned with a systemic totality. Amidst such turmoil, this writing does not appear as a literary critique nor does it claim a fully sociological analysis. Instead, it aims to provide a report and interpretation of the influential tendencies in several Persian novels of the decade that has passed: the 1390s (Iranian calendar). Accordingly, one major theme of this report is how history is narrated within the hidden and silent context of literary works. It involves a dialectical inquiry into the political unconscious and the dominant class culture within literary works and their relationship with sustaining ideologies.
